I remember talking to Dutch at the Round Up Cafe. He could be there any time of day and was always interesting to talk to.

I remember Dutch flying past me in his Crew Cab Dodge on the way to Lawton

I remember Dutch sorting through used rod bearings to find the least worn ones to use.

I remember Dutch sitting on the front tire of his race car adjusting the valves. Did I mention that his race car was on the trailer on the way to the races?

Of course I remember Dutch on the front straight. If it had been anyone else, it would have been a bad deal but with Dutch it was classic.

This is a little fuzzy but wasn't there a 2 day show where Dutch blew a hole in the side of the block in hotlaps, qualified on 5 cylinders, then changed the motor for the next day?
